Thermalright launches new Frozen Horizon Digital ARGB AIO liquid coolers with an LCD

Thermalright is bringing back a familiar name from its product stack, a refresh of its Frozen Horizon AIO liquid cooler. The new Frozen Horizon Digital features a new temperature display on the pump block and replaces the fans with the latest models, featuring RGB strips on the frame.

The most notable addition of the new Frozen Horizon Digital ARGB AIO is the digital display located on top of the water block. Rather than a complex, fully customisable LCD screen, this is a more straightforward display designed to provide at-a-glance information on your processor's temperature, a helpful feature for any PC user.

Thermalright has also changed its approach with the included fans. The Frozen Horizon Digital, which is available in black and white, has its RGB lighting toned down, shipping with TL-Q12 fans. These 120mm fans are rated to spin up to 2000 RPM, delivering a claimed 68.9 CFM of airflow and 2.20mmH2O of static pressure, indicating a focus on practical performance over flashy aesthetics.

The core of the cooler appears to be essentially unchanged from its original design. It uses a standard 27mm thick aluminium radiator, available in 240mm and 360mm sizes. For those planning a new build, the mounting hardware has been updated to support all modern sockets, including AM4, AM5, and Intel's upcoming LGA 1851 platform.
